WebCardiff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der Prescribing Algorithm Introduction Post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) is a common mental disorder that may develop after exposure to a particularly distressing and catastrophic event. The disorder is characterised by symptoms of re-experiencing, hyperarousal, avoidance, and altered mood and cognition1.

WebPost-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) is a mental illness. You can develop it after experiencing something that you find traumatic. This can include seeing or hearing about something traumatic. The symptoms of PTSD can start immediately or after a delay of weeks or months. They usually start within 6 months of the traumatic event. cyrs cleaning
